1. FAQ
  2. 엑셀(Excel)
  3. AfterEffects
  4. Premiere
  5. Photoshop
  6. ETC

이 게시판은 아별닷컴 회원만 질문을 올릴 수 있습니다. 회원에게 주어지는 특권인셈이지요. 회원이 아닌 분들은 열람만 가능합니다.

열숨기기 기능에 대해서

조회 수 4333 추천 수 0 2011.07.14 16:43:04

 

 

안녕하세요

 

초복인데 닭은 드셨나요?

 

또 엑셀에 대해서 질문드릴게요

 

엑셀에서 열숨기기에서

 

위와 같이 ABCD열이 셀병함된상태에서 D 열만 셀숨기기 하였습니다.

매크로로 할려고

Columns("D:D").Select
    Selection.EntireColumn.Hidden = True

이렇게 했는데 실행시키면

A,B,C,D열이 한꺼번에 숨겨집니다. 셀병합때문에 그런건가요?

해결책이 없을까요?

 

 

 

A

B

C

D

E

F

G

1

2

11

12

13

14

15

16

17


댓글 '3'

profile

[레벨:30]아별

2011.07.14 17:40:58
*.104.126.21

말키리님.. 굿 애프터누운~ 입니다.

졸리네요.. 퇴근할때가 되서 그런지.. ㅎㅎ

 

아래처럼 하시면 됩니다.

Sub columHide()
    Columns("D:D").Hidden = True
End Sub

 

올리신 코드에서..

Columns("D:D").Select 하는 순간~ A:D열이 선택이 됩니다..

보통 매크로 기록기로 기록하면 저렇게 나오는데요..

굳이 선택한 다음에 선택한걸 숨길필요는 없습니다. 바로 숨기면 됩니다.

 

참고로..

Columns("D:D") 자체가 EntireColumn이기 때문에

Columns("D:D").EntireColumn 라고 쓰실 필요는 없습니다.

보통 Range()와 함께 EntireColumn을 많이 쓰지요.

Range("F1").EntireColumn.Hidden = True

 

 

 즐거운 하루 되세요.. ^^)/

[레벨:3]말키리

2011.07.15 16:44:18
*.7.245.16

아하~~ 그렇게 하니 되네요 매번감사드려요

함수를 잘몰라서 매크로 기록으로 짜집기하고 있었는데

저런 방법이 있었네요...

profile

[레벨:30]아별

2011.07.15 17:49:15
*.104.126.21

저도 처음 VBA시작할때 경험했던 거네요..

매크로 기록하면.. 꼭.. Select한 다음에.. Selection으로 무언가 작업을 하더라구요..

.Select와 Selection.은 없애도 무방한 경우가 많습니다.

 

이로서... 한단계 업그레이드 되셨네요~ 유후~ ^^

문서 첨부 제한 : 0Byte/ 2.00MB
파일 제한 크기 : 2.00MB (허용 확장자 : *.*)
List of Articles
번호 제목 글쓴이 날짜 조회 수sort
공지 공지 [공지] 아별닷컴의 엑셀 질문방 폐쇄합니다. 카페 질문방 이용하세요.. imagefile [레벨:30]아별 2015-04-23 137262
642 도와주세요. 엑신~~ [3] [레벨:2]리자딘 2009-07-03 7694
641 의미없는 행 삭제관련 [3] [레벨:3]말키리 2011-05-12 7691
640 엑셀에서 sheet 보호를 한상태로는 셀병합이라던지 그런건 할수 없는건가요? [1] [레벨:2]코요태 2010-02-05 7690
639 엑셀수식 두 엑셀 파일 비교 file [1] [레벨:1]랄랄라99 2013-08-16 7682
638 다른시트에 조건부 수식 넣어서 합계 내는 법 file [2] [레벨:3]이구람 2010-01-11 7681
637 '근무일수를 소수점 월단위표기' 관련 질문 두번째 입니다~^^ [2] [레벨:1]리시안샤스 2009-07-22 7680
636 단축키에 대해서 여쭈어 봐용 ^0^ [3] 고득녕 2010-04-12 7679
635 SUMIF 일자와 연동되는 누적합계 만들기 _ SUMIF file [4] [레벨:2]진주22 2012-04-24 7674
634 엑셀일반 엑셀파일 암호걸기 (확장자 csv) [레벨:1]한우리 2014-03-04 7673
633 각 시트의 2개이상 조건값이 같을 때 해당값을 찾는 함수??? imagefile [1] [레벨:2]qpfmdpfm 2010-04-15 7655
632 차트안의 데이타 자동 변경방법 알려주세요^^ [3] [레벨:6]ryanoh 2010-03-30 7651
631 엑셀일반 경력 합산 file [4] [레벨:3]읍내꽃미남 2014-01-07 7623
630 자동으로 계산할 수 있는 방법이 있나요? file [2] [레벨:3]유령 2010-05-03 7621
629 엑셀 매크로 작성입니다. file [1] [레벨:1]유니현 2009-12-07 7617
628 pivot 기본 피벗보고서에 있는 데이터 가져오기 file [3] [레벨:1]예진 2013-02-24 7575
627 셀서식(표시형식) 엑셀 피벗테이블 셀서식에 관한 내용입니다. [1] [레벨:2]Merak 2013-01-11 7558
626 차트 동적차트 질문드리겟습니다. file [5] [레벨:4]신강현 2013-05-30 7547
625 엑신께 질문합니다!!!!! [2] 엑셀초봅자 2009-07-03 7541
624 abyul Excel Tool관련 문의 [1] [레벨:1]겸둥이 2009-07-02 7534
623 엑셀일반 칸에 맞게 붙여넣기 하는법이 궁금해요! imagefile [1] [레벨:1]냠냠이 2015-01-04 7533